- 积分
- 16840
在线时间 小时
最后登录1970-1-1
|
马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。
您需要 登录 才可以下载或查看,没有账号?开始注册
x
Unexpected API Error. <class 'nova.exception.NeutronAdminCredentialConfigurationInvalid'> (HTTP 500) 解决办法
. x1 d" m( H9 J: }
3 @5 R4 F/ E) v8 T6 dhttp://controller:8774 "POST /v2.1/servers HTTP/1.1" 500 None. H# O. ^! I7 N8 |/ \8 A% v) x
RESP: [500] Content-Type: application/json; charset=UTF-8 openstack-API-Version: compute 2.1 Vary: openstack-API-Version, X-OpenStack-Nova-API-Version X-OpenStack-Nova-API-Version: 2.1 x-compute-request-id: req-af926773-9a0d-4738-b788-16283f94be0d x-openstack-request-id: req-af926773-9a0d-4738-b788-16283f94be0d
2 I% N, Z T+ {RESP BODY: {"computeFault": {"code": 500, "message": "Unexpected API Error. Please report this at http://bugs.launchpad.net/nova/ and attach the Nova API log if possible.\n<class 'nova.exception.NeutronAdminCredentialConfigurationInvalid'>"}}
* Y: c ^3 I; [0 V! e t2 yPOST call to compute for http://controller:8774/v2.1/servers used request id req-af926773-9a0d-4738-b788-16283f94be0d
; t# B, u, B. h% x& \9 CUnexpected API Error. Please report this at http://bugs.launchpad.net/nova/ and attach the Nova API log if possible.
" X& S9 V8 H. [8 E" z) H$ P. V<class 'nova.exception.NeutronAdminCredentialConfigurationInvalid'> (HTTP 500) (Request-ID: req-af926773-9a0d-4738-b788-16283f94be0d)8 q. L' H/ ]7 I8 P. |
Traceback (most recent call last):
% ?# K, G0 Y9 r6 A7 B& o File "/usr/lib/python3/dist-packages/cliff/app.py", line 410, in run_subcommand
2 M. x* W; D. W% e* T: n& f result = cmd.run(parsed_args)
, s, o8 B1 o6 }9 G; r! O ^^^^^^^^^^^^^^^^^^^^
/ Y- d; v$ y3 N/ O File "/usr/lib/python3/dist-packages/osc_lib/command/command.py", line 39, in run) v0 I8 E4 J( E, a0 Z
return super(Command, self).run(parsed_args)) L6 u+ h) [# u, @
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^0 M6 A/ f: _' a4 C+ W" @# J
File "/usr/lib/python3/dist-packages/cliff/display.py", line 115, in run. T" y; _( C" U3 ~/ ?
column_names, data = self.take_action(parsed_args)
9 J6 N' W2 ^. O. d3 J: x9 q2 t 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^& O" G: s f" a) R2 w# {
File "/usr/lib/python3/dist-packages/openstackclient/compute/v2/server.py", line 1729, in take_action0 f% X: p1 e! G
server = compute_client.servers.create(*boot_args, **boot_kwargs)8 W# c) t, Z1 M, a( f) F
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
8 V6 |) C7 N3 H4 U$ c% z File "/usr/lib/python3/dist-packages/novaclient/v2/servers.py", line 1562, in create
; O; J9 e3 h5 T$ c; w/ E7 B+ @ return self._boot(response_key, *boot_args, **boot_kwargs)
( l m7 |$ S$ y- i6 M: P 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^7 l# U( B" I0 Z! F) L
File "/usr/lib/python3/dist-packages/novaclient/v2/servers.py", line 887, in _boot
, @! q1 Q( `& _- F5 H0 q return self._create('/servers', body, response_key,6 x; }1 G7 v& [0 I; `2 y
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^1 N6 y6 Y. D; {9 A
File "/usr/lib/python3/dist-packages/novaclient/base.py", line 363, in _create
& A O2 q) n2 o' A resp, body = self.api.client.post(url, body=body)
$ d9 g, ]; E0 q( @2 p 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
x3 L! N) L! {" r7 F9 G" A' a File "/usr/lib/python3/dist-packages/keystoneauth1/adapter.py", line 401, in post: \# {# Q ^& A
return self.request(url, 'POST', **kwargs)+ _; L% k8 J' a# z6 s) m) z
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
; }+ m. Q$ A6 m& c- { File "/usr/lib/python3/dist-packages/novaclient/client.py", line 78, in request2 S6 Z9 c P3 g, v
raise exceptions.from_response(resp, body, url, method)
. K6 D: x; \ Jnovaclient.exceptions.ClientException: Unexpected API Error. Please report this at http://bugs.launchpad.net/nova/ and attach the Nova API log if possible.1 f/ S3 {/ ~9 N3 e" q8 \
<class 'nova.exception.NeutronAdminCredentialConfigurationInvalid'> (HTTP 500) (Request-ID: req-af926773-9a0d-4738-b788-16283f94be0d)
, G4 }* d3 G& |" e: Y8 B2 pclean_up CreateServer: Unexpected API Error. Please report this at http://bugs.launchpad.net/nova/ and attach the Nova API log if possible.! v7 @7 S- z2 U& i
<class 'nova.exception.NeutronAdminCredentialConfigurationInvalid'> (HTTP 500) (Request-ID: req-af926773-9a0d-4738-b788-16283f94be0d)
7 d1 D1 z) X. F* r! }0 R; KEND return value: 10 w1 p+ d8 x9 ^+ ~5 @6 ~
7 L( I5 ^' N1 P$ S! c) f" [5 ?0 Z' y6 F& k7 x" A
解决办法:8 l6 `! ^, J0 ^$ e6 B
修改nova.conf和neutron.conf 文件中 keystone_authtoken项 service_token_roles_required = false , 如果是true 一定要改成false。
; O R0 s5 j4 Q6 m0 Y |
|